# Partner SFTP drop — Fernbrook feed ingest.
# Plugin authors: do not change the host or port values; those are
# pinned per Fernbrook's allowlist. Polling interval is in seconds.
# Files land in /inbound and are deleted after parse. Keep this file
# out of your plugin repo. The drop credential goes on the next line.

sealed setting: COURIER_KEY13=1033dd92e5af1

**Ticket: Config drift on BounceSift processor**

The email bounce processor in the Larkfield environment has drifted from the values committed in the release branch. Retry windows and suppression thresholds no longer match, which likely explains the duplicate suppression entries reported Tuesday. Please reconcile before the Thursday cut. For reference, the currently deployed configuration on the live node reads as follows.

config for yajep-yahof:
[briax]
port = 9200
region = outer-2
host = briax.nelvrocorp.test
team = raleth
timeout_ms = 1500
retries = 1

The LiftSim dispatch simulator exposes a read-only REST interface for reviewing queued car assignments and synthetic passenger traffic. All endpoints require transport encryption and reject unauthenticated requests with a 401. Rate limits are enforced per credential, and audit logs record every call with its originating key. For the security review environment, requests must present the internal service key, which is provided below.

gateway credential: kto23_LX9A4ys6i4nzHtpOLNLodKK

CI Troubleshooting: Relevance Tuning Docs Job (Saltmere Search)

Welcome aboard. The docs-check job that validates our search relevance tuning notes sometimes fails when the Saltmere index fixtures drift from the committed snapshots. Before assuming your change broke anything, regenerate the fixtures with the refresh script and re-run the job locally. If scores still diverge by more than 0.02, flag it to the ranking channel rather than force-merging. Reference the failing run using the trace token below.

trace token, fafog-kageg: htk4_98e6